Output 4628a116e154f6738c3deed07bfc3bd128485b389dca9a88740f7db95866cde9:29

value
525234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b446ac1dc213139450a438179824d30b7aab4304 OP_EQUAL
address
3J8EDUNYbG3HomngqGoj8aR1STyj2S4ztQ
transaction
4628a116e154f6738c3deed07bfc3bd128485b389dca9a88740f7db95866cde9
confirmations
320049
spent
true